FIGURE 12 in The genus Mecodema Blanchard 1853 (Coleoptera: Carabidae: Broscini) from the North Island, New Zealand
FIGURE 12. Ventral view of the mentum with a number of different character states. Illustrations A–D are the different forms of the indentation in the apex of the median process: (A) distinctly indentate (M. manaia); (B) moderately indentate (M. pluto); (C) slightly indentate (M. infimate); (D) indentation notched (M. parataiko). Illustrations E–G are the three general forms (i.e., hashed lines) of the mentum lobes: (E) triangular; (F) rounded; (G) squared.
FIGURE 7. The North Island, New Zealand with the entomological regions indicated with a in The genus Mecodema Blanchard 1853 (Coleoptera: Carabidae: Broscini) from the North Island, New Zealand
FIGURE 7. The North Island, New Zealand with the entomological regions indicated with a two-letter code as per Crosby et al. (1976). Note: For the purpose of the species distributions, the Three Kings Islands are included within the Northland (ND) region. The presence of each North Island Mecodema species within a region are indicated by the box with an arrow to that region. The species names in bold font are endemic to that region, i.e. the Auckland region has eight species of which six are endemic (bold font).
FIGURE 8 in The genus Mecodema Blanchard 1853 (Coleoptera: Carabidae: Broscini) from the North Island, New Zealand
FIGURE 8. Detail of the ventral head with the taxonomic structures used in the species descriptions. SBMS = submentum setae; SBM = submentum sclerite; ML = mentum lobe; MP = mentum process (with indentation); MPW = mentum process width; SBS = stipes basal setae; MPL = mentum process length; MPS = mentum process setae; SBMC = submentum sclerite constriction; GP = gula pits; GS = gula suture.

FIGURE 5 in The genus Mecodema Blanchard 1853 (Coleoptera: Carabidae: Broscini) from the North Island, New Zealand
FIGURE 5. The entire female reproductive tract (ventral view) including taxonomic structures (for all other abbreviated structure names see Seldon et al. 2012). However, for this revision only the following structures are important: HS = helminthoid sclerite; G1 = gonocoxite 1; G2 = gonocoxite 2; TDC = transverse dorsal carina; R = ramus.

FIGURE 2 in The genus Mecodema Blanchard 1853 (Coleoptera: Carabidae: Broscini) from the North Island, New Zealand
FIGURE 2. Ventral view of a Mecodema specimen showing specific morphological structures, excluding taxonomic structures indicated in detail figures, used in the species descriptions. ƑLF = ventrite lateral foveae; ƑSP = ventrite setose punctures; MTC = metacoxa; MTƑP = metaventrite process; MSC = mesocoxa; PC = procoxa; PS = prosternum; G = gena; PES = proepisternum; MSE = mesepisternum; MTE = metepisternum; Ƒ1–Ƒ6 = ventrites 1-6 (ventrites 1-3 may be fused); M = midline (dashed line, not a taxonomic structure).
